Heatwave Influences on Natural Habitats

Heatwaves are becoming ever more common and intense due to altered climate, profoundly influencing our biomes. High temperatures can lead to altered habitat conditions, altering the continuation and reproduction of diverse species. Many plants and animals have particular temperature ranges in which they prosper; beyond these ranges, physiological stress may arise, leading to declines in population and biodiversity.

Aquatic ecosystems are especially vulnerable to heat waves. Rising water temperatures can lower oxygen levels in aquatic environments, causing stress for fish and other water-dwelling organisms. Additionally, heat waves can worsen the consequences of contamination and nutrient runoff, leading to harmful algal blooms that can further harm water quality and jeopardize aquatic life. The domino effects of these conditions can interrupt food webs and lead to long-term ecological imbalances.

On land, heatwaves can disrupt plant life cycles, impacting flowering and fruiting patterns. Many species find it difficult to adapt effectively to sudden temperature changes, which can lead to discrepancies in timing between plants and their cross-pollinators or fruit dispersers. As ecosystems transition in response to heatwaves, the robustness of these systems is strained, potentially leading to long-lasting changes that impact our planet’s long-term biodiversity.

Those Thawing Ice Caps: A Global Concern

The melting ice caps are a stark reminder of the urgency of climate change and its far-reaching effects on our planet. As global temperatures continue to rise, ice sheets in the Arctic and Antarctica are shedding millions of tons of ice each year. This phenomenon not only contributes to rising sea levels but also poses significant threats to coastal communities around the world. The visible decline of these once-mighty ice formations serves as a call to action for leaders and citizens alike to confront the realities of a warming planet.

Increased heatwaves and changing weather patterns are linked to the loss of ice coverage, which disrupts the Earth’s natural systems. As the ice melts, it alters ocean currents and affects climate regulation across the globe. This instability can lead to more extreme weather events, further compounding the challenges faced by vulnerable populations, particularly in low-lying coastal regions.
